Brandon Straka and his team from #WalkAway headed to Chicago for the LGBT Town Hall event at a space called Theater Wit. They had signed contracts, paid for the event- AFTER clearly telling the venue who they are and what the event is. The event, like all #WalkAway Town Halls, was to be an open forum discussion about why various minority groups are voting democrat at such high rates. The venue cancelled the event with less than 24 hours notice to find a new venue, calling #WalkAway a hate group and a “bunch of online trolls”.
Because of the tenacity of #WalkAway’s team, they were able to secure a new venue at last minute, and the #WalkAway LGBT Town Hall, Chicago was a huge success.
